Microsoft takes back the words regarding the price hype of Xbox Live Gold membership. The membership prices have been increased recently, which for most of the users is a kind of unfair decision.

However, with a substantial inadequate response regarding the prices increasing, the company has decided not to increase the prices at all. Microsoft also announced that the Free to play games would not require Xbox Live Gold subscriptions.

The membership prices were increased recently, in which the one-month subscription price was increased from $10 to $11. However, there is a $5 hype in the three-month subscription. This pricing was for just the new members as mentioned.

They came up with a new decision, in which there will be no price increase for all members. The members will have to continue the subscription for the same price.

Membership Current Prices

  • 1-month membership ($9.99)
  • 3 months membership ($24.99)
  • 6 months membership (39.99)
  • 12 months membership (59.99)

According to Microsoft, all the prices will be the same as before, and the free to play games will further not require Xbox Live Gold membership. Also, the company is working hard to deliver this change ASAP shortly.
